Captain Yiannis Tzortzis
The captain of Daiquiri is Yiannis Tzortzis, also known as a captain with a pleasant character with over 30 years of sailing experience as part of his pure love for sea activities. He was born in Athens and he is a brilliant father of two lovely kids.
His high responsibility and natural talent to work under pressure are two powerful endorsements he gained from his successful career in Mechanical Engineering. For over the last 20 years, Yiannis has been working as a professional skipper in both sailing and motor yachts in the Mediterranean (Italy, Croatia, Greece in particular) and the Caribbean (Dominican Republic), is a RYA/MCA Yachtmaster.
Yiannis is passionate about the sea and sailing; a true sea lover with two mottos: “Safety first” & “an amazing charter for Yiannis is made of a strong team of 4 professionals who works as one to provide you an exceptional service”.
He is an excellent trainer in both sailing and water ski, really dedicated to serving his co-sailors every single day.The great experience of him, has given the convenience and the pleasure to sail with guests at the most amazing and secret spots of Greek & Mediterranean seas! Also, he is certified of «GMDSS/GO», «Medical Care», « Medical First Aid», «STCW/95 B. Safety Course», «Crowd & Crisis Management Ro/Ro Passengers», «Survival at Open Seas», «PADI Open Seas Scuba» and «IATA/UFTA F. Diploma».
In addition, he has been a pilot in cessna aircraft (172)
As a Captain, with his professional attitude and friendliness, he makes all the guest feel welcome to enjoy their sailing holiday of a lifetime!

Languages: Greek and English (fluent)

Rates 2022 July/August : 39800 EUR per week June/September: 34900 EUR per week Low Season: 34900 EUR per week Charters for less than a week are only available upon request and the weekly rate is divided by 6.
